The Most Popular Side Hustles Today

With the rise of digital platforms and technological advancements, a multitude of side hustle opportunities have emerged. Here are some of the most popular:

1. Freelancing

Platforms like Upwork and Fiverr are booming with opportunities for freelancers to offer services ranging from writing and graphic design to programming and marketing.

2. Ridesharing and Delivery Services

Companies like Uber, Lyft, and DoorDash provide flexible opportunities for people to earn money with their vehicles, capitalizing on the gig economy.

3. Online Selling

Platforms such as Etsy, eBay, and Amazon offer marketplaces for selling handmade crafts, vintage items, or retail arbitrage goods.

4. Content Creation

From YouTube channels to podcasts, content creation has become a lucrative way to monetize passion projects.

Challenges Faced by Side Hustlers

While side hustles offer many benefits, they also present unique challenges:

  • Time Management: Balancing a full-time job with side projects can be overwhelming.
  • Income Unpredictability: Unlike a steady paycheck, side hustle income can vary drastically each month.
  • Lack of Benefits: Most side hustles do not offer health insurance, retirement plans, or paid leave.

Strategies for Successful Side Hustling

To maximize the benefits of side hustles while minimizing stress, consider these strategies:

1. Set Clear Goals

Define what you want to achieve with your side hustle, whether it’s saving for a specific goal or eventually turning it into a full-time career.

2. Create a Schedule

Establish a routine that allows you to dedicate sufficient time to both your full-time job and your side hustle without overextending yourself.

3. Invest in Tools and Education

Invest in the right tools and education to enhance your efficiency and skill set, leading to better opportunities and higher earnings.

4. Network and Build Relationships

Connect with others in your field to share experiences, gain insights, and explore collaboration opportunities.
